Dogs’ need for exercise varies depending on their age, size, breed and individual traits. read more

Puppies have a lot of energy, but they wear out quickly, and don’t need as much exercise as an adult dog. They’re growing nonstop, and take frequent naps, so plan on shorter bursts of energy from your puppy. In general, puppies need several short (5-10 minutes) exercise sessions throughout the day. read more
